We enjoyed our re-booked Camino Portuguese. The walk from Lisbon to O Porto was harder than we thought it would be...some very long walks back to back, combined with hot weather. From O Porto to Santiago de Compostela, up the Atlantic Coast was wonderful.

Overall, I had a great time. Love that the group size was small at only 20 people. It meant that the group hung out together a lot and our tour guide got to know us quite well. I think the tour should be longer such as 13-15 days rather than 10. We didn’t get enough time in places to really ‘delve deep’ such as Porto and Barcelona. I’d suggest 2 nights in each major destination so we can really explore a place. I think this would help with the long drives in Spain as well. Would recommend as a taster to Portugal and Spain!

This was my third cycling trip with Exodus but the first one that is more or less hotel-to-hotel cycling, with only a bus transfer at the end to get to Lisbon. I loved that the focus was very much on cycling (as opposed to other trips that combine the cycling with lots of sightseeing) and the pace was nice and relaxed. I'm a pretty fit 40-year-old and, yes, I could've cycled faster and further and I still would've enjoyed it but for an active holiday that's not super-strenuous this was perfect. Since I loved the cycling so much I found the beginning of the tour in Porto and the end of the tour in Lisbon to be the least enjoyable. In fact, I think it would be better if the final day was a choice between a day trip to Lisbon for those who want it or an additional day's cycling around Óbidos. Most of us signed up for a walking tour in Lisbon, organised for us by our cycling tour leader, but for me this was definitely the most disappointing part of the whole trip since the guide just wasn't very good. In general, we were all left to our own devices in Lisbon and somehow it felt like an anticlimax after the five days' cycling togather. However, there were plenty of other positive points - the accomodation was of a very good standard and all the hotel breakfasts were delicious, the bikes were pretty good, and the cycling routes were a lovely mixture of coastal roads and forest paths.
